17.Foods such as applesauce, cranberries, pearl barley, oatmeal or other
cereals, split peas, noodles and pasta or rhubarb should not
be cooked under pressure in the pressure cooker. These foods tend
to foam, froth and sputter and may block the Pressure Indicator Valve.
18.Do not use appliance for other than intended use.
19.Extreme caution must be used when moving an appliance containing
hot liquids.
20.WARNING: Never deep fry or pressure fry in the pressure cooker. It
is dangerous and may cause a re or serious damage.
21.DO NOT operate while unattended.
22.This appliance cooks under pressure. Improper use may result in
scalding injury.
23.Ensure that the unit is properly closed before operating. See HOW
TO USE instructions.
24.Always check the pressure release devices for clogging before use.
25.After cooking, use extreme caution when removing the Cover.
Serious burns can result from steam inside the unit. Do not open
the pressure cooker until the unit has cooled and all internal pressure
has been released. If the cover is difcult to turn this indicates the
cooker is still pressurized. Do not force it open. Any pressure in the
cooker can be hazardous. See the HOW TO REMOVE THE COVER
instructions.
26.DO NOT damage the silicone gasket. DO NOT replace it with
anything other than the replacement gasket designated for this
appliance.
27.DO NOT tamper with the Metal Ring in the cover. If the steel Metal
Ring is damaged stop using the cooker immediately and replace the
cover.
28.Clean the safety devices after each use.
29.NEVER use additional weight on the pressure regulator or replace it
with anything not intended for use with this unit.
30.Do not use without the Removable Cooking Bowl in place. Only use
the Removable Cooking Bowl designed for this unit. Do not use the
Removable Cooking Bowl with other heating sources.
31.To avoid scratching the non-stick surface on the Removable Cookng
Bowl use only wooden or plastic utensils.
32.Keep hands and face away from the pressure regulator knob when
releasing pressure.
33.While the unit is in operation, never remove the Cover.
34.Do not cover the pressure valves. An explosion may occur.
35.Do not attempt to dislodge food when the appliance is plugged in.
